Softer Hard Scattering and Noncommutative Gauge-String Duality

We study exclusive scattering of `hadrons' at high energy and fixed angle in (nonconformal) noncommutative gauge theories. Via gauge-string duality, we show that the noncommutativity renders the scattering soft, leading to exponential suppression. The result fits with the picture that, in noncommutative gauge theory, fundamental partons consist of extremely soft constituents and `hadrons' are made out of open Wilson lines.
